Description

In the shadows of war, their voices resonate: Australian veterans' tales
In "Never Forgotten," Vietnam Veteran Dave Morgan explores the often-overlooked sacrifices of Australian military personnel. Inspired by his own experiences, Dave embarks on a journey to capture the diverse narrative spanning generations and conflicts, from Vietnam to Somalia and Afghanistan.

Through meticulous research, he uncovers untold stories, from talented athletes like Ian Anderson, Kevin Sheedy, to pioneering female veterans like Stephanie Shipman. The book weaves together tales of camaraderie and resilience, from heartwarming reunions to the loss of friends . "Never Forgotten" serves as a poignant reminder of the sacrifices made by those who serve, ensuring their voices resonate for future generations.

These accounts offer a mosaic of bravery and resilience and through these stories, readers gain a deeper understanding of the profound impact of military service on individuals and communities, highlighting the importance of preserving these invaluable narratives.

Author Bio

Dave Morgan, born in Melbourne in 1948, embarked on a life shaped by adventure and resilience. Joining the Army in 1969, he served in Vietnam with the 104 Signal Squadron, facing the harsh realities of war. Despite his silent struggles with Post Traumatic Stress Disorder upon returning, he built a life with his wife Deb and children David and Michelle. Now retired, he confronts his demons, seeking treatment for PTSD, a journey Antarctica forced him to acknowledge. He has authored four books.
